Noise

While most washers make humming or clicking sounds that are considered normal, some can make loud noises when they are in the spin cycle. This kind of sound is typically signalling an imbalanced load. The solution is to pause your machine and distribute your laundry prior to continuing the process. A loud thud during the spin cycle may be an indication that the washer is too heavily loaded. This can be fixed by redistributing the load and adding or removing items as needed.

During the spin cycle, the washer generates vibrations that cause items to shake and rattle within the drum. This can be particularly annoying if the washer is located in an open-plan living space however there are ways to minimize the noise. The rattling sound is typically caused by zips or buttons that get caught in the lint filter and door seal. In some instances, the rattling can be corrected by simply pulling up the lint trap and removing any stuck objects.

If the noise is louder than usual, it could be an even more serious issue. This can be a sign of a damaged shock absorber on a front-load washer, or an inefficient balance spring on a top-load washer. It is recommended to contact a repair specialist immediately, since these issues can cause damage and expensive breakdowns.
